[Word][1] เป็นรูปแบบเอกสารประมวลผลคำที่ได้รับความนิยมสูงสุด ซึ่งพัฒนาโดย Microsoft ช่วยให้คุณสร้าง แก้ไข ดู และแชร์เอกสารของคุณอย่างรวดเร็วและง่ายดายโดยใช้แอปพลิเคชัน Word [PDF][2] เป็นรูปแบบเอกสารพกพาที่พัฒนาโดย Adobe เป็นหนึ่งในประเภทไฟล์ที่ใช้บ่อยที่สุดในปัจจุบันเพื่อปกป้องและรักษาความปลอดภัยของเอกสาร เอกสาร Word จัดรูปแบบเอกสารใหม่และไม่มีการรักษาความปลอดภัยที่ดีสำหรับการแชร์ข้อมูลประวัติ แม้ว่า PDF จะคงรูปแบบไว้ แต่ก็รองรับการจัดการไฟล์ที่ยอดเยี่ยมและการรักษาความปลอดภัยเพื่อปกป้องข้อมูลที่ละเอียดอ่อนของคุณโดยใช้รหัสผ่านหรือใบรับรองการเข้ารหัส ในกรณีเช่นนี้ เราอาจต้องแปลงไฟล์ Word เป็นรูปแบบ PDF ดังนั้น ในบทความนี้ ฉันจะสาธิตวิธีแปลง Word เป็น PDF โดยทางโปรแกรมใน C# โดยใช้ REST API
หัวข้อต่อไปนี้จะครอบคลุมในบทความนี้:
[ API การแปลงเอกสารและไฟล์ - ไลบรารีรูปแบบไฟล์ .NET][3]
[แปลง Word เป็น PDF โดยทางโปรแกรมใน C# โดยใช้ REST API][4]
[แปลงไฟล์ DOCX เป็น PDF ใน C# โดยใช้ตัวเลือกขั้นสูง][5]
[วิธีแปลงช่วงของหน้าจาก Word เป็น PDF ใน C#][6]
[วิธีแปลงหน้าเฉพาะของ Word เป็น PDF ใน C#][7]
API การแปลงเอกสารและไฟล์ - ไลบรารีรูปแบบไฟล์ .NET#
ฉันจะใช้ [.NET SDK][8] ของ GroupDocs.Conversion Cloud API เพื่อแปลงเอกสาร Word เป็น PDF เป็น SDK บนระบบคลาวด์ที่มีคุณลักษณะหลากหลายและมีประสิทธิภาพสูงสำหรับแปลงเอกสารและรูปภาพกว่า 50 ประเภท รวมทั้ง PDF, HTML, CAD, ภาพแรสเตอร์ และอื่นๆ อีกมากมาย GroupDocs.Conversion Cloud API ช่วยให้คุณสามารถแปลงและดึงข้อมูลเฉพาะรูปแบบจากรายการ [รูปแบบเอกสารต้นฉบับที่รองรับ] จำนวนมากเป็นรูปแบบเป้าหมายที่รองรับ มีชุดการตั้งค่าที่ยืดหยุ่นเพื่อปรับแต่งกระบวนการแปลง ปัจจุบันยังมี C#, Java, PHP, Ruby, Python และ Node.js SDK เป็น [สมาชิกตระกูลการแปลงเอกสาร][10] สำหรับ Cloud API
แปลง Word เป็น PDF โดยทางโปรแกรมใน C# โดยใช้ REST API#
การแปลงเอกสาร Word เป็น PDF อาจเป็นวิธีที่มีประโยชน์ในการรักษารูปลักษณ์และความปลอดภัยของเอกสาร และทำให้แชร์กับผู้อื่นได้ง่ายขึ้น ใน CSharp คุณสามารถแปลง Word Doc เป็นไฟล์ PDF โดยใช้ REST API โดยทำตามขั้นตอนด้านล่าง
คุณสามารถแปลงหน้าที่เลือกของไฟล์ Word เป็นไฟล์ PDF เพื่อจุดประสงค์นี้ คุณต้องระบุช่วงของหน้าตามที่แสดงในตัวอย่างโค้ดด้านล่าง แปลงช่วงของหน้าจากเอกสาร Word เป็นไฟล์ PDF โดยทางโปรแกรมโดยทำตามขั้นตอนด้านล่าง:
ตัวอย่างโค้ดต่อไปนี้แสดงวิธีแปลงหน้าเฉพาะของเอกสาร Word เป็น PDF โดยใช้ REST API ใน C#:
// วิธีแปลงหน้าเฉพาะของ Word เป็น PDF โดยใช้ CSharp
using System;
using System.Collections.Generic;
using GroupDocs.Conversion.Cloud.Sdk.Api;
using GroupDocs.Conversion.Cloud.Sdk.Client;
using GroupDocs.Conversion.Cloud.Sdk.Model;
using GroupDocs.Conversion.Cloud.Sdk.Model.Requests;
namespace GroupDocs.Conversion.CSharp
{
// แปลงหน้าเฉพาะของ Word เป็น PDF โดยใช้ CSharp
class Convert_Specific_Pages_of_Word_To_PDF
{
static void Main(string[] args)
{
try
{
// สร้างอินสแตนซ์ API ที่จำเป็น
var apiInstance = new ConvertApi(configuration);
// เตรียมการตั้งค่าการแปลง
var settings = new ConvertSettings
{
FilePath = "csharp-testing/input-sample-file.docx",
Format = "pdf",
LoadOptions = new DocxLoadOptions { Password = "password" },
ConvertOptions = new PdfConvertOptions
{
Pages = new List<int?> {1, 2} // Page numbers starts from 1
},
OutputPath = "csharp-testing/output-sample-file.pdf"
};
// แปลงเป็นรูปแบบที่กำหนด
var response = apiInstance.ConvertDocument(new ConvertDocumentRequest(settings));
Console.WriteLine("Successfully converted specific pages of Word file to PDF file format: " + response[0].Url);
}
catch (Exception e)
{
Console.WriteLine("Exception when calling GroupDocs ConvertApi: " + e.Message);
}
}
}
}
``` โปรดทำตามขั้นตอนที่กล่าวถึงก่อนหน้านี้เพื่ออัปโหลดและดาวน์โหลดไฟล์
วิธีแปลงหน้าเฉพาะของ Word เป็น PDF ใน C#
## Word เป็น PDF Converter ออนไลน์ฟรี
วิธีแปลง Word เป็น PDF ออนไลน์ฟรี โปรดลองใช้ Word เป็น PDF ออนไลน์ฟรีต่อไปนี้ [converter][25] โดยไม่ต้องเปลี่ยนรูปแบบเพื่อแปลง DOCX เป็น PDF ออนไลน์ฟรี ซึ่งพัฒนาโดยใช้ API ข้างต้น
## บทสรุป
เราขอจบบทความนี้ไว้ที่นี่ ในโพสต์บล็อกนี้ เราได้เรียนรู้:
* วิธีแปลงเอกสาร Word เป็นไฟล์ PDF บนคลาวด์
* แปลงหน้าที่เลือกจาก DOCX เป็น PDF โดยทางโปรแกรมใน C#;
* วิธีแปลงหน้าเฉพาะของเอกสาร Word เป็น PDF โดยใช้ C#
* อัปโหลดไฟล์ DOCX โดยทางโปรแกรมบนคลาวด์ จากนั้นดาวน์โหลดไฟล์ PDF ที่แปลงแล้วจากคลาวด์
นอกจากนี้ คุณสามารถเรียนรู้เพิ่มเติมเกี่ยวกับ GroupDocs.Conversion Cloud API โดยใช้ [เอกสารประกอบ][26] นอกจากนี้ เรายังมีส่วน [การอ้างอิง API][27] ที่ช่วยให้คุณแสดงภาพและโต้ตอบกับ API ของเราได้โดยตรงผ่านเบราว์เซอร์
สุดท้าย [groupdocs.com][28] กำลังเขียนบทความบล็อกใหม่เกี่ยวกับโปรแกรมแปลงไฟล์ออนไลน์ระหว่างไฟล์หลายรูปแบบ ดังนั้นโปรดติดตามการอัปเดตอย่างสม่ำเสมอ
## ถามคำถาม
สำหรับข้อสงสัย/การสนทนาเกี่ยวกับตัวแปลง Word DOCX เป็น PDF โปรดไปที่ [ฟอรัมสนับสนุนฟรี][29]
## คำถามที่พบบ่อย {#faqs}
ฉันจะแปลงไฟล์ DOCX เป็น PDF โดยไม่ต้องเปลี่ยนฟอนต์ได้อย่างไร
โปรดติดตาม [ลิงก์นี้][30] เพื่อเรียนรู้ข้อมูลโค้ด C# สำหรับวิธีสร้าง pdf จาก word อย่างรวดเร็ว
จะดาวน์โหลดเอกสาร Word เป็น PDF ได้อย่างไร
ติดตั้งซอฟต์แวร์แปลง word เป็น PDF [ดาวน์โหลดไลบรารี C# ฟรี][31] เพื่อสร้าง ดาวน์โหลด และประมวลผลการแปลง Word DOCX เป็น PDF โดยทางโปรแกรม
ฉันจะแปลงเอกสาร Word เป็น PDF ออฟไลน์ใน windows ได้อย่างไร
โปรดไปที่ [ลิงก์นี้](https://releases.groupdocs.app/total/windows/) เพื่อดาวน์โหลดซอฟต์แวร์แปลง Word เป็น PDF ฟรีสำหรับ Windows ซอฟต์แวร์แปลง Word เป็น PDF นี้จะทำการแปลงอย่างรวดเร็วด้วยการคลิกเพียงครั้งเดียว
วิธีแปลงไฟล์ DOC เป็น PDF ออนไลน์ฟรี
[ตัวแปลง DOC เป็น PDF ออนไลน์ฟรี](https://products.groupdocs.app/conversion/docx-to-pdf) ช่วยให้คุณแปลงเอกสาร Word เป็นรูปแบบ PDF ได้อย่างรวดเร็วและง่ายดาย เมื่อการแปลงเสร็จสิ้น คุณสามารถดาวน์โหลดไฟล์ PDF
## ดูสิ่งนี้ด้วย* [วิธีแปลง EXCEL เป็น JSON และ JSON เป็น EXCEL 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-excel-to-json-and-json-to-excel-in-python/)
* [วิธีแปลง PDF เป็นเอกสาร Word ที่แก้ไขได้โดยใช้ Node.js](https://blog.groupdocs.cloud/th/conversion/convert-pdf-to-editable-word-document-using-node-js/)
* [แปลงเอกสาร Word เป็น PDF โดยใช้ REST API 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-word-documents-to-pdf-using-rest-api-in-python/)
* [วิธีแปลง PDF เป็น Excel ใน Python โดยใช้ REST API](https://blog.groupdocs.cloud/th/conversion/convert-pdf-to-excel-in-python-using-rest-api/)
* [แปลง CSV เป็น JSON และ JSON เป็น CSV 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-csv-to-json-and-json-to-csv-in-python/)
* [แปลงรูปภาพ PowerPoint PPT/PPTX เป็น JPG/JPEG 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-powerpoint-pptpptx-to-jpgjpeg-images-in-python/)
* [แปลง HTML เป็น PDF โดยทางโปรแกรมโดยใช้ REST API 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-html-to-pdf-using-rest-api-in-python/)
* [แปลง Excel เป็น CSV โดยทางโปรแกรมโดยใช้ REST API 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-excel-to-csv-using-rest-api-in-python/)
* [ค้นหาและแทนที่ลายน้ำในเอกสารโดยใช้ REST API](https://blog.groupdocs.cloud/th/watermark/find-and-replace-watermark-using-rest-api/)
* [แปลง XML เป็น CSV และ CSV เป็น XML ใน Python](https://blog.groupdocs.cloud/th/conversion/convert-xml-to-csv-and-csv-to-xml-in-python/)
[1]: https://docs.fileformat.com/word-processing/docx/
[2]: https://docs.fileformat.com/pdf/
[3]: #CSharp-Document-and-File-Conversion-API-and-dotNET-SDK
[4]: #Convert-Word-to-PDF-Programmatically-in-CSharp-using-REST-API
[5]: #Convert-DOCX-File-to-PDF-in-CSharp-using-Advanced-Options
[6]: #How-to-Convert-Range-of-Pages-from-Word-to-PDF-in-CSharp
[7]: #How-to-Convert-Specific-Pages-of-Word-to-PDF-in-CSharp
[8]: https://products.groupdocs.cloud/conversion/net/
[9]: https://docs.groupdocs.cloud/conversion/supported-document-formats/
[10]: https://products.groupdocs.cloud/conversion/family/
[11]: https://www.nuget.org/packages/GroupDocs.Conversion-Cloud/
[12]: https://dashboard.groupdocs.cloud/
[13]: #Upload-the-Word-Document
[14]: #Convert-Word-File-to-PDF-Online
[15]: #Download-the-Converted-File
[16]: https://apireference.groupdocs.cloud/merger/#/File/UploadFile
[17]: https://apireference.groupdocs.cloud/conversion/#/Convert
[18]: https://apireference.groupdocs.cloud/conversion/#/Convert/ConvertDocument
[19]: https://apireference.groupdocs.cloud/conversion/#/Convert
[20]: https://apireference.groupdocs.cloud/conversion/#/Convert/ConvertDocument
[21]: https://apireference.groupdocs.cloud/conversion/#/Convert
[22]: https://apireference.groupdocs.cloud/conversion/#/Convert/ConvertDocument
[23]: https://apireference.groupdocs.cloud/conversion/#/Convert
[24]: https://apireference.groupdocs.cloud/conversion/#/Convert/ConvertDocument
[25]: https://products.groupdocs.app/conversion/docx-to-pdf
[26]: https://docs.groupdocs.cloud/conversion/
[27]: https://apireference.groupdocs.cloud/conversion/
[28]: https://blog.groupdocs.cloud/th/category/conversion/
[29]: https://forum.groupdocs.cloud/c/conversion/11
[30]: https://blog.groupdocs.cloud/th/conversion/convert-word-to-pdf-programmatically-in-csharp/#Convert-Word-to-PDF-Programmatically-in-CSharp-using-REST-API
[31]: https://github.com/groupdocs-conversion-cloud/groupdocs-conversion-cloud-dotnet